==STRUCTURE OF A BASIC PHOSPHOLIPASE A2 FROM AGKISTRODON HALYS PALLAS AT 2.13A RESOLUTION==
-
The basic phospholipase A2 isolated from the venom of Agkistrodon halys, Pallas (Agkistrodon blomhoffii Brevicaudus) is a hemolytic toxin and one, of the few PLA2's capable of hydrolyzing the phospholipids of E. coli, membranes in the presence of a bactericidal/permeability-increasing, protein (BPI) of neutrophils. The crystal structure has been determined, and refined at 2.13 A to an R factor of 16.5% (F &gt; 3sigma) with excellent, stereochemistry. A superposition of the two molecules in the asymmetric, unit gives an r. m.s. deviation of 0.326 A for all Calpha atoms. The, refined structure allowed a detailed comparison with other PLA2 species of, known structures. The overall architecture is similar to those of other, PLA2's with a few significant differences. == Function ==
 +
[https://www.uniprot.org/uniprot/PA2BB_GLOHA PA2BB_GLOHA] Snake venom phospholipase A2 (PLA2) that shows potent hemolytic activity, and exhibits medium anticoagulant effects by binding to factor Xa (F10) and inhibiting the prothrombinase activity (IC(50) is 90 nM). It is one of the few phospholipases A2 capable of hydrolyzing the phospholipids of E.coli membranes in the presence of a bactericidal/permeability-increasing protein (BPI) of neutrophils. PLA2 catalyzes the calcium-dependent hydrolysis of the 2-acyl groups in 3-sn-phosphoglycerides.<ref>PMID:18062812</ref> <ref>PMID:10728829</ref>
